What You're Getting

The Transcend ESD360C is a 4TB portable SSD built around a USB 3.2 Gen 2x2 interface that pushes read and write speeds up to 2,000 MB/s. The drive is credit-card sized and meets MIL-STD-810G drop-test standards for drops up to 3 meters, so it can handle life in a bag.

It works across Windows, macOS, iOS, iPadOS, and Android, and ships with both USB Type-C and Type-A cables. A one-touch auto-backup button works with Transcend Elite software for instant backups.

It also carries a five-year limited warranty.
